Core Insights - The LED display market is projected to reach USD 8.105 billion by 2026, driven by events like the World Baseball Classic and FIFA World Cup, as well as the demand for high-resolution displays in corporate, educational, and entertainment sectors [2][19]. Micro/Mini LED Displays - Continuous optimization of Micro LED technology and cost by brands and panel manufacturers is expected to lead to stable growth in Micro LED TV shipments, particularly in home theater and corporate markets [5][6]. - The Mini LED display market is anticipated to grow by 25% in 2025, with P1.2 being the mainstream product, and a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 28% projected from 2024 to 2029, potentially reaching USD 2.194 billion [6]. All-in-One LED Displays - The global demand for All-in-One LED displays is expected to rise, with shipments projected to reach 12,850 units in 2025. Major players include CVTE, Absen, and Samsung [8][9]. - From 2025, mainstream specifications will shift towards a 16:9 aspect ratio, with 135-inch 2K P1.5 models becoming prevalent, enhancing portability and reducing operational costs [9]. Cinema LED Displays - The Chinese government's promotion of cinema LED displays is expected to drive a 75% increase in new installations globally by 2025, with specifications typically ranging from 1.85:1 to 2.39:1 [11][31]. Virtual Production LED Displays - The demand for virtual production LED displays is anticipated to decline in 2025 due to reduced entertainment spending in Western markets and decreased social investment in China [13][14]. - Major companies are developing comprehensive virtual production solutions, with mainstream specifications focusing on P2.1 and higher for general backgrounds, while high-end filming requires P1.2-P1.6 Mini LED displays [14]. LED Rental Displays - The popularity of LED rental displays is increasing as prices decline, with a projected market size of USD 2.244 billion by 2029 and a CAGR of 8% from 2024 to 2029 [16]. Outdoor LED Displays - The outdoor LED display market is expected to grow steadily, particularly in advertising, transportation, and sports applications, with advancements in Mini LED technology enhancing display quality [18].

Core Viewpoint - The article discusses the accelerating penetration of Micro LED technology in consumer electronics, highlighting its potential to transform various sectors, including televisions, smartwatches, and automotive displays, with a projected market value of $461 million by 2029 [2][4]. Group 1: Market Trends and Projections - Micro LED technology is expected to see significant growth, with Samsung launching a 140-inch Micro LED TV in 2023 and Garmin planning to introduce the Fenix 8 Pro smartwatch with Micro LED technology by 2025 [2]. - The market value of Micro LED chips is projected to reach $461 million by 2029, driven by the introduction of key products across various applications [2][4]. Group 2: Competitive Landscape - Current challenges for Micro LED include high power consumption and pricing, making it difficult to compete with more mature OLED technology in the short term [4]. - Despite these challenges, Micro LED's ability to meet the high brightness demands of outdoor environments and its potential for integrating sensing components position it favorably for future innovation [4]. Group 3: Industry Collaboration and Supply Chain - The Garmin Fenix 8 Pro smartwatch will utilize components from AUO, PlayNitride, and Raydium, showcasing the evolving Micro LED supply chain and its readiness for commercialization [4]. - The collaboration among various companies in the Micro LED ecosystem indicates a growing interest and investment in this technology, paving the way for further advancements and cost optimization [4].
